Section 535.220 - Submission of application for approval of plans for decommissioning of dam
1. A person who is required by NRS NRS NRS 535.010 to file an application for approval of plans for the decommissioning of a dam must submit to the State Engineer in person or by mail:
(a) The application; and
(b) Three copies of the plans and specifications, including, without limitation:
(1) A design report;
(2) The specifications for construction; and
(3) A set of plans.

Each element of the plans and specifications must be prepared by or under the supervision of a professional engineer and must bear the wet stamp and signature of the professional engineer.

2. The application must:
(a) Be on a form provided by the State Engineer;
(b) Be Complete; and
(c) Bear the original signature of each owner of the dam or an agent authorized to sign the application on behalf of the owner.
3. The design report must include, without limitation:
(a) A detailed description of the proposed work;
(b) Discussions of:
(1) The plan for release of water impounded by the dam;
(2) The stabilization of sediment;
(3) The anticipated consequences to persons and property located downstream from the dam;
(4) Design features to prevent a sudden release of water or slope failure during decommissioning; and
(5) Erosion control; and
(c) If a breach in an embankment of the dam is designed with a bottom width that is less than the height of the embankment, calculations that establish the slope stability of the walls of the breach.
4. The specifications for construction must:
(a) Address all aspects of construction;
(b) Include a schedule of testing for quality assurance and quality control;
(c) Provide a precise citation to the location of any other common specification to which it refers;
(d) Be on standard paper that is 8 1/2 by 11 inches in size; and
(e) Set forth the sequence of activities, including a timetable.
5. The plans must:
(a) Depict the proposed work adequately and include, without limitation:
(1) A cover sheet that includes, without limitation:
(I) The name of each owner of the dam;
(II) The name of the dam; and
(III) A location plat that shows at least one section corner;
(2) A second sheet which includes a plan view of the existing dam and impoundment that shows, without limitation:
(I) The alignments of cross sections of the dam showing proposed alterations to the dam and impoundment;
(II) The reference point of the dam, tied to a found section corner and identified by latitude and longitude; and
(III) Section corners and elevation contours; and
(3) A third sheet which includes a plan view of the dam and impoundment at the completion of decommissioning that shows, without limitation:
(I) Details of proposed alterations to the dam and impoundment, including any new construction for the purposes of erosion control; and
(II) Representative cross sections through the dam, breach and impoundment.
(b) Show a tie with bearing and distance to a found section corner from a reference point on the existing dam. The reference point must be on the long axis at the station where the toe is at the lowest elevation. If no single point meets this criterion, the reference point must be at the intersection of the long axis and the centerline of the principle outlet.
(c) Unless the use of exaggerated dimensions is necessary for clarity, have the same vertical and horizontal scales.
6. For the purposes of determining whether a person is required to apply for approval of plans for the decommissioning of a dam pursuant to paragraph (b) of subsection 2 of NRS NRS NRS 535.010, the State Engineer will calculate the capacity of the dam as the volume of water, expressed in acre-feet, detained above the anticipated elevation of the lowest point on the toe of the dam.
7. As used in this section, "decommissioning" includes breaching and removing.
